      Meaning of the first name Tonauac

      Origin

      Native American

      Meaning

      Unyielding or Enduring

      Variations

      Tonatiuh, Tonatzin, Tonda
      The name Tonauac originates from Native American culture, embodying the meanings unyielding or enduring. It reflects a sense of strength and resilience, characteristics highly valued in various indigenous narratives and traditions. Such names often carry profound significance, encapsulating the spirit and qualities attributed to the individuals who bear them. The term suggests a steadfastness that resonates with the experiences and challenges faced by Native American communities throughout history.
